Key Distinctions In Between Bonds and Insurance policy



Comprehend the 5 key differences in between guaranty performance bonds and standard insurance coverage to make a notified choice for your particular requirements.

First, the purpose of a surety bond is to ensure the performance of a professional, while insurance coverage gives financial security against losses.

Second, surety bonds need a three-party arrangement in between the principal, the obligee, and the surety, while insurance coverage involves just two celebrations, the insured and the insurance company.

Third, guaranty bonds concentrate on avoiding loss by ensuring the conclusion of a task, while insurance coverage concentrates on compensating for losses that have currently occurred.

4th, surety bonds require the principal to indemnify the guaranty for any kind of insurance claims paid, while insurance policy doesn't need this.

Ultimately, guaranty bonds are underwritten based on the principal's monetary strength and record, while insurance coverage is based upon threat assessment and actuarial calculations.

Comprehending these differences will certainly aid you select the right alternative for your details scenario.
